two water tanks are leaking water. the equation and the table each represent the gallons of water in the tank, y, as a function of time in minutes, x. how much water does tank a hold before it starts to leak? find the initial value. 900 gallons how much water does tank b hold before it starts to leak? find the initial value. gallons tank a: y = 900 - 11x tank b: minutes, x | water in tank (gal), y 0 | 985 1 | 975 2 | 965 3 | 955
Step1: Understand Initial Value
The initial value (water before leaking) occurs at \( x = 0 \) (time = 0 minutes).
Step2: Find Tank B's Initial Value
For Tank B, look at the table. When \( x = 0 \) (minutes), the water \( y \) is 985 gallons.
